Dating from the early 19th century, North Lodge, Small Hill Road, Leigh, Reigate, is a magnificent five bedroom period family home in private grounds of 2.7 acres, that has been sympathetically extended over the years. This glorious period home was originally the lodge house for the Mynthurst Estate, which is an impressive country mansion located at the top of the hill. 

Visitors are met by a great sense of style and character when they enter North Lodge, thanks to the beautiful original features throughout this home. These include original wrought iron gates, stone mullion windows, moulded panelled doors and period fireplaces. 

North Lodge comes with a detached barn/studio, delightful gardens and fine views over the surrounding countryside toward the North Downs.

The gardens are perfect for entertaining, with an attractive patio directly outside the orangery, making for an excellent seating area designed to capture the sun. There is a driveway that leads to the detached double garage and parking.
